From: Larval metamorphosis is inhibited by methimazole and propylthiouracil that reveals possible hormonal action in the mussel Mytilus coruscus

Figure 1

Multiple sequence alignment of two M. coruscus deiodinases with the deiodinases from vertebrates and invertebrates. The conserved active catalytic centers of the deduced amino acid sequences are indicated in orange. Identical amino acids are presented in black, similar amino acids in grey. An asterisk indicates a selenocysteine. HsD1 (Homo sapiens, AAB23670), HsD2 (H. sapiens, AAD45494), HsD3 (H. sapiens, AAH17717), DrD1 (Danio rerio, NP_001007284), DrD2 (D. rerio, NP_997954), DrD3 (D. rerio, NP_001242932), GgD1 (G. gallus, NP_001091083), GgD2 (G. gallus, AAD33251), GgD3 (G. gallus, NP_001116120), HrDx (Halocynthia roretzi, AAR25890), CgDx (C. gigas AKF17655), CgDy (C. gigas AKF17656), AfDx (A. farreri, AEX08671), McDx (M. coruscus, MW928627) and McDy (M. coruscus, MW928628).
